Handover — loading dock, Merrow Building. Deliveries run 07:00–11:00 weekdays only; nothing after 11:00 without prior sign-off from Facilities. Courier firm Swiftbarrow knows the window; the new grocer does not, so expect pushback. Log every arrival in the dock book. The roller shutter stays down between deliveries. To open the dock-side personnel door for drivers, use the entry code noted below.

staff pass of kawip-hawef = bdg-QLP-2

The ticket-pricing experiment (variant ladder B) is behaving differently in production versus what the experiment spec says. Discount floors in prod are 5% looser than the committed values, and the rollout percentage appears to have been hand-edited on two hosts around last Tuesday. This ticket tracks reconciling prod back to source control; please review the accompanying PR against the committed spec rather than what's live. For comparison, the values currently running in production are pasted below.

settings of yageg-yahap:
[gorael]
team = olieth
access_code = ac_941d74
owner = brieth.aldiel
host = gorael.tolvaqio.internal
port = 6379
peer = briwyn.urlaqtech.internal
salt = 116e6622
pin = 1957

- [ ] Step 7: Archive cold storage buckets (Glacierline tier). Confirm both ceremony witnesses are present, verify bucket manifests match the Oxbow ledger, then seal the archive key shares. Plugin authors may observe but not handle shares. Once sealed, the archive index itself is encrypted and can only be reopened with the passphrase below.

vault phrase of badup-hahig = tamael-aldael-kelmir-istael-fenok-istwyn-tamius-jorath-oliion